Safe House 2 is here! Thanks to the community's support, we'll once again be living it up in Las Vegas and casting some StarCraft. More money will be going to the players and qualifiers will give any Americas-based player the chance to play in the main event. Tournament Structure:Day 1: Saturday, Oct 18 5:00pm GMT (GMT+00:00)8 Player Round Robin BO3s -> Top 4 Advance Day 2: Sunday, Oct 19 5:00pm GMT (GMT+00:00)Single elimination bracket - BO7 semis, BO9 finals Main Streams:ZombieGrub TwitchZombieGrub YouTubeCommentators + Analysts:ZombieGrub feardragon ZergGirl Chickenman Steadfast State Round Robin B Streams:TBD, Ask to cover Non-English Streams:TBD, Ask to cover Players: trigger Epic * Astrea ChamNA Qualifier #1 Top 2 NA Qualifier #1 Top 2 NA Qualifier #2 Top 2 NA Qualifier #2 Top 2 *Epic may not be available, in which case Dolan will replace him.
